Crash victims still critical



DANVILLE — A Valley teenager and a woman involved in two separate crashes late last week both remain in critical condition at Geisinger Medical Center.

Morgan Yagel, 16, and Brittany Eshenaur, 21, were critical Saturday night according to the hospital nursing supervisor.

Yagel, of Danville, was injured Thursday on Route 642 in Liberty Valley Township when her sport-utility vehicle crashed into a fence and telephone pole and rolled several times before coming to rest on its roof. She was thrown from the vehicle.

Eshenaur, of Freeburg, was injured Friday when her vehicle was stopped in the southbound lane of Route 35 east of Freeburg, waiting to turn left. Her vehicle was struck from behind by a 1998 Chevrolet Lumina driven by Jeffrey Leitzel, of Richfield. The impact forced Eshenaur’s car into the northbound lane, where it was struck by a 2004 Jeep Liberty driven by Gary Carstettler, of Freeburg.
